Garages and Sheds

Wasp infestations in garages and sheds are often attributed to the sheltered and secluded environment these structures provide, making them ideal nesting spots for these insects. The attraction lies in the protection from elements and human interference. We specialise in the eradication of wasp nests in these areas, ensuring the safety and peace of mind of our customers by effectively removing these potential hazards.

Wasp Fact: Did you know that by the end of summer, there could be around 6000 wasps in a nest!!!

How do I know if I have a wasp problem?

To find out if there is a wasp problem, we need to observe the presence of wasps and their nest in and around your property. Here are some signs that indicate a wasp infestation:

  • Frequent sightings of wasps flying around your property
  • A high number of wasps entering and exiting a specific area
  • Discovering a wasp nest on your property, such as in trees, eaves, or attics

If you suspect a wasp infestation, it is crucial to contact professionals for effective wasp treatment and control.

How Weather Affects Wasps In Tattenhall

Seasonal weather shifts have a significant impact on wasp activity. Warm, sunny days tend to increase their presence outdoors as they search for food, while sudden rain or chilly temperatures often push them closer to homes and gardens in search of shelter. Understanding how changing conditions influence wasp behavior can help you minimize risks and maintain a more comfortable environment.

Can wasps nest underground?

Yes, some wasp species, like ground-nesting wasps, create nests in burrows in the soil.

Can wasp stings cause long-term health issues?

While most people experience only temporary discomfort from wasp stings, individuals with allergies may face more severe reactions.

Do wasps hibernate during the winter?

Most wasp species don't hibernate. Instead, the colony dies, and only the queen survives by finding shelter.
